示例1: eglCreatePbufferSurface

bool EGLPlatform::initSurface()
{
	// create the surface
#if USE_PBUFFER
	EGLint attribs[] = {
		EGL_WIDTH, width,
		EGL_HEIGHT, height,
		EGL_TEXTURE_FORMAT, EGL_TEXTURE_RGBA,
		EGL_TEXTURE_TARGET, EGL_TEXTURE_2D,
		EGL_NONE
	};
	this->surface = eglCreatePbufferSurface(this->display, this->config, attribs);
#elif USE_PIXMAP
	EGLint attribs[] = {EGL_NONE};
	this->surface = eglCreatePixmapSurface(this->display, this->config, this->pixmap, attribs);
#else
	EGLint attribs[] = {EGL_NONE};
	this->surface = eglCreateWindowSurface(this->display, this->config, this->window, NULL);
#endif
	if(this->surface == EGL_NO_SURFACE)
	{
		printf("Error: EGL surface creation failed (error code: 0x%x)\n", eglGetError());
		return false;
	}
	
	return true;
}

示例2: m_display

EglContext::EglContext(EglContext* shared) :
m_display (EGL_NO_DISPLAY),
m_context (EGL_NO_CONTEXT),
m_surface (EGL_NO_SURFACE),
m_config  (NULL)
{
    // Get the initialized EGL display
    m_display = getInitializedDisplay();

    // Get the best EGL config matching the default video settings
    m_config = getBestConfig(m_display, VideoMode::getDesktopMode().bitsPerPixel, ContextSettings());
    updateSettings();

    // Note: The EGL specs say that attrib_list can be NULL when passed to eglCreatePbufferSurface,
    // but this is resulting in a segfault. Bug in Android?
    EGLint attrib_list[] = {
        EGL_WIDTH, 1,
        EGL_HEIGHT,1,
        EGL_NONE
    };

    m_surface = eglCheck(eglCreatePbufferSurface(m_display, m_config, attrib_list));

    // Create EGL context
    createContext(shared);
}

示例6: make_pbuffer

static void
make_pbuffer(int width, int height)
{
   static const EGLint config_attribs[] = {
      EGL_RED_SIZE, 8,
      EGL_GREEN_SIZE, 8,
      EGL_BLUE_SIZE, 8,
      EGL_BIND_TO_TEXTURE_RGB, EGL_TRUE,
      EGL_NONE
   };
   EGLint pbuf_attribs[] = {
      EGL_WIDTH, width,
      EGL_HEIGHT, height,
      EGL_TEXTURE_FORMAT, EGL_TEXTURE_RGB,
      EGL_TEXTURE_TARGET, EGL_TEXTURE_2D,
      EGL_NONE
   };
   EGLConfig config;
   EGLint num_configs;

   if (!eglChooseConfig(dpy, config_attribs, &config, 1, &num_configs) ||
       !num_configs) {
      printf("Error: couldn't get an EGL visual config for pbuffer\n");
      exit(1);
   }

   ctx_pbuf = eglCreateContext(dpy, config, EGL_NO_CONTEXT, NULL );
   surf_pbuf = eglCreatePbufferSurface(dpy, config, pbuf_attribs);
   if (surf_pbuf == EGL_NO_SURFACE) {
      printf("failed to allocate pbuffer\n");
      exit(1);
   }
}

示例11: eglSetup

    /*
     * Sets up EGL.  Creates a 1280x720 pbuffer, which is large enough to
     * cause a rapid and highly visible memory leak if we fail to discard it.
     */
    bool eglSetup() {
        static const EGLint kConfigAttribs[] = {
                EGL_SURFACE_TYPE, EGL_PBUFFER_BIT,
                EGL_RENDERABLE_TYPE, EGL_OPENGL_ES2_BIT,
                EGL_RED_SIZE, 8,
                EGL_GREEN_SIZE, 8,
                EGL_BLUE_SIZE, 8,
                EGL_NONE
        };
        static const EGLint kContextAttribs[] = {
                EGL_CONTEXT_CLIENT_VERSION, 2,
                EGL_NONE
        };
        static const EGLint kPbufferAttribs[] = {
                EGL_WIDTH, 1280,
                EGL_HEIGHT, 720,
                EGL_NONE
        };

        //usleep(25000);

        mEglDisplay = eglGetDisplay(EGL_DEFAULT_DISPLAY);
        if (mEglDisplay == EGL_NO_DISPLAY) {
            ALOGW("eglGetDisplay failed: 0x%x", eglGetError());
            return false;
        }

        EGLint majorVersion, minorVersion;
        if (!eglInitialize(mEglDisplay, &majorVersion, &minorVersion)) {
            ALOGW("eglInitialize failed: 0x%x", eglGetError());
            return false;
        }

        EGLConfig eglConfig;
        EGLint numConfigs = 0;
        if (!eglChooseConfig(mEglDisplay, kConfigAttribs, &eglConfig,
                1, &numConfigs)) {
            ALOGW("eglChooseConfig failed: 0x%x", eglGetError());
            return false;
        }

        mEglSurface = eglCreatePbufferSurface(mEglDisplay, eglConfig,
                kPbufferAttribs);
        if (mEglSurface == EGL_NO_SURFACE) {
            ALOGW("eglCreatePbufferSurface failed: 0x%x", eglGetError());
            return false;
        }

        mEglContext = eglCreateContext(mEglDisplay, eglConfig, EGL_NO_CONTEXT,
                kContextAttribs);
        if (mEglContext == EGL_NO_CONTEXT) {
            ALOGW("eglCreateContext failed: 0x%x", eglGetError());
            return false;
        }

        return true;
    }

示例15: halide_opengl_create_context

WEAK int halide_opengl_create_context(void *user_context) {
    if (eglGetCurrentContext() != EGL_NO_CONTEXT)
        return 0;

    EGLDisplay display = eglGetDisplay(EGL_DEFAULT_DISPLAY);
    if (display == EGL_NO_DISPLAY || !eglInitialize(display, 0, 0)) {
        error(user_context) << "Could not initialize EGL display: " << eglGetError();
        return 1;
    }

    EGLint attribs[] = {
        EGL_SURFACE_TYPE, EGL_PBUFFER_BIT,
        EGL_RENDERABLE_TYPE, EGL_OPENGL_ES2_BIT,
        EGL_RED_SIZE, 8,
        EGL_GREEN_SIZE, 8,
        EGL_BLUE_SIZE, 8,
        EGL_ALPHA_SIZE, 8,
        EGL_NONE,
    };
    EGLConfig config;
    int numconfig;
    eglChooseConfig(display, attribs, &config, 1, &numconfig);
    if (numconfig != 1) {
        error(user_context) << "eglChooseConfig(): config not found: "
                            << eglGetError() << " - " << numconfig;
        return -1;
    }

    EGLint context_attribs[] = {
        EGL_CONTEXT_CLIENT_VERSION, 2,
        EGL_NONE
    };
    EGLContext context = eglCreateContext(display, config, EGL_NO_CONTEXT,
                                          context_attribs);
    if (context == EGL_NO_CONTEXT) {
        error(user_context) << "Error: eglCreateContext failed: " << eglGetError();
        return -1;
    }

    EGLint surface_attribs[] = {
        EGL_WIDTH, 1,
        EGL_HEIGHT, 1,
        EGL_NONE
    };
    EGLSurface surface = eglCreatePbufferSurface(display, config,  surface_attribs);
    if (surface == EGL_NO_SURFACE) {
        error(user_context) << "Error: Could not create EGL window surface: " << eglGetError();
        return -1;
    }

    eglMakeCurrent(display, surface, surface, context);
    return 0;
}
